5 Must-See Christmas Shows in Chicago 2026
A Christmas Carol at Goodman Theatre
A bold, stirring retelling of Dickens’ classic. Expect heartfelt performances set in a cozy, intimate venue that feels like being invited into Scrooge’s very parlor. Perfect for those craving authenticity wrapped in a blanket of nostalgia. Discover ‘A Christmas Carol’ at Goodman Theatre.
Holiday Spectacular at Chicago Theater
More than a play: it’s a vibrant celebration packed with music and dazzling costumes. This show captures the city’s diverse spirit, making it great for families seeking an all-ages, high-energy holiday outing. Don’t miss the iconic Chicago Theater’s glowing atmosphere. Twas the Night Before Christmas
A charming, playful adaptation of the timeless poem. Ideal for littler audiences who believe in magic—and adults who refuse to stop believing. The intimate storytelling here makes each twinkle of holiday lights feel personal. The Nutcracker Ballet
A Chicago holiday tradition blending elegance and whimsy. The intricate choreography and lush score guarantee an enchanting evening, perfect for ballet fans and first-timers alike. Elf The Musical
A rollicking, laugh-out-loud adaptation of the holiday movie hit. If you want an uproarious night that feels like a warm hug from the North Pole, this is your show. Ideal for groups looking for pure fun without a lot of fuss.

FAQs About Christmas Shows in Chicago 2026
When do Christmas shows in Chicago typically start?
Most kick off in late November through December, with some extending into early January. Check official theater calendars frequently for precise dates.
Are there kid-friendly Christmas shows in Chicago?
Absolutely. Productions like ‘Twas the Night Before Christmas’ and ‘Elf The Musical’ are perfect for young audiences, while others welcome all ages. Always check age recommendations before booking.
Is it easy to get tickets to popular shows like A Christmas Carol?
Tickets tend to sell out quickly. For guaranteed seats, purchase early through official theater websites like Goodman Theatre’s official site.
Are there any free or outdoor Christmas theater options?
While most big-name shows charge admission, Chicago hosts various free or donation-based holiday events and performances in parks or public spaces. Keep an eye on community calendars.
What should I wear to a Christmas theater show in Chicago?
Dress warmly! Chicago winters are cold. Opt for layered clothing plus comfortable shoes, especially if you plan to explore nearby holiday markets or ice skating rinks before or after the show.
